Découvrez cette Technique Méconnu et Transformer Votre Approche de Collecte des Données en Ligne.
Le Web Scraping, une technique puissante, ouvre une porte vers un océan d'informations en ligne. Dans cet article, nous plongerons profondément dans le monde du Web Scraping, expliquant en quoi il consiste, comment il fonctionne et pourquoi il est essentiel pour de nombreuses entreprises. Que vous soyez un professionnel des données, un entrepreneur ou simplement curieux, découvrez comment le Web Scraping peut transformer la manière dont vous accédez aux données sur Internet.
Le Web Scraping, également connu sous le nom d'extraction de données sur le web, est devenu l'une des compétences les plus recherchées dans l'univers de la technologie de l'information. Il s'agit d'une technique qui permet d'extraire automatiquement des informations à partir de sites web et de les convertir en données structurées. Alors que le web regorge de données précieuses, le Web Scraping offre un moyen efficace d'accéder à ces informations à grande échelle.
Le processus de web scraping implique plusieurs étapes. Tout d'abord, vous devez identifier les données que vous souhaitez extraire d'un site web. Ensuite, vous utilisez un programme ou un logiciel spécifique pour collecter ces données en envoyant des requêtes au serveur du site web et en analysant les réponses reçues. Enfin, vous pouvez enregistrer les données extraites dans un format structuré, tel que CSV ou JSON, pour une utilisation ultérieure.
Le Web Scraping offre de nombreux avantages, notamment :
Bien que le Web Scraping offre de nombreux avantages, il comporte également des défis et des préoccupations :
Le web scraping soulève souvent des questions juridiques, car il peut être utilisé à des fins illégales, telles que le vol de contenu ou le spamming. Cependant, le web scraping est légal dans de nombreux cas, tant que vous respectez certaines règles. Les lois varient d'un pays à l'autre, il est donc important de se familiariser avec les réglementations locales.
Dans l'ensemble, le Web Scraping est autorisé tant qu'il respecte les lois canadiennes sur la protection des données et le droit d'auteur, ainsi que les conditions d'utilisation spécifiques du site web ciblé.
Aux États-Unis, le web scraping est généralement légal tant qu'il n'enfreint pas les lois sur le droit d'auteur, le vol de données ou la violation des conditions d'utilisation d'un site web. Cependant, la jurisprudence dans ce domaine est en constante évolution, il est donc essentiel de consulter un avocat spécialisé si vous avez des doutes.
En Europe, la législation sur le web scraping varie d'un pays à l'autre. Dans certains pays, il est autorisé de collecter des données publiques à des fins non commerciales, tandis que dans d'autres pays, il peut y avoir des restrictions plus strictes. En France, par exemple, le web scraping est légal dans la mesure où il n'enfreint pas les lois sur le droit d'auteur et le respect de la vie privée.
Le web scraping a de nombreuses applications dans différents domaines et industries. Voici quelques exemples d'utilisation du web scraping pour différents types d'entreprises :
Maintenant que nous avons une compréhension de base du Web Scraping, explorons ses applications potentielles dans le monde réel. Voici quelques exemples de domaines et d'entreprises qui bénéficient grandement de cette technique :
Pour bien comprendre le web scraping, il est important de faire la distinction entre le web scraping et le web crawling. Alors que le web scraping consiste à extraire des données spécifiques à partir d'une page web, le web crawling est le processus de collecte systématique des données à partir de plusieurs pages web.
Le web scraping est généralement utilisé pour extraire des informations spécifiques, telles que des prix, des avis clients, etc., à partir d'une page web. En revanche, le web crawling est utilisé pour collecter de grandes quantités de données à partir de plusieurs pages web, par exemple pour indexer le contenu d'un site web ou pour construire un moteur de recherche.
Lorsque vous pratiquez le web scraping, il est important de suivre certaines bonnes pratiques pour éviter les problèmes juridiques et les blocages de site web.
Avant de commencer à scraper un site web, assurez-vous de lire attentivement les conditions d'utilisation du site. Certains sites peuvent interdire explicitement le scraping, tandis que d'autres peuvent imposer des restrictions sur la fréquence des requêtes ou sur le type de données collectées. Il est important de respecter ces règles pour éviter les problèmes juridiques.
Lorsque vous effectuez du web scraping, il est essentiel de limiter la fréquence des requêtes pour ne pas surcharger le serveur du site web. En général, il est recommandé d'espacer les requêtes d'au moins quelques secondes, voire quelques minutes, pour éviter d'être considéré comme un bot malveillant.
Certains sites web peuvent bloquer les adresses IP qui effectuent un grand nombre de requêtes en peu de temps. Pour éviter d'être bloqué, vous pouvez utiliser des proxies pour masquer votre adresse IP réelle et distribuer les requêtes sur plusieurs adresses IP.
Il est temps de choisir l'outil adapté à vos besoins. Voici trois options populaires pour ceux qui recherche un outil de niveau intermédiaire à avancé ou pour ceux qui n’ont pas nécessairement de base en programmation :
Hexomatic est une solution de Web Scraping hautement personnalisable qui permet aux utilisateurs d'extraire des données à partir de sites web complexes avec facilité. Il offre une interface conviviale et prend en charge plusieurs langages de programmation, ce qui en fait un choix polyvalent pour les projets de Web Scraping.
Fonctionnalités :
Avantages :
Inconvénients :
Browse AI est une solution de Web Scraping automatisée alimentée par l'IA. Il est conçu pour extraire des données à partir de sites web de manière intelligente, en utilisant des algorithmes d'apprentissage automatique pour reconnaître et collecter des informations.
Fonctionnalités :
Avantages :
Inconvénients :
Zyte est une plateforme de Web Scraping professionnelle qui offre des outils puissants pour extraire des données de sites web de grande envergure. Il propose une suite complète d'outils pour le scraping, le stockage, la gestion et l'analyse des données.
Fonctionnalités :
Avantages :
Inconvénients :
Choisir le bon outil dépendra de vos besoins spécifiques, de votre niveau de compétence technique et de l'envergure de votre projet de Web Scraping. Chacune de ces solutions offre ses propres avantages et inconvénients, alors assurez-vous de sélectionner celle qui correspond le mieux à vos exigences.
Le web scraping est une technique puissante qui permet d'extraire des données à partir de sites web. Que ce soit pour la prospection commerciale, la veille concurrentielle, l'analyse de marché, ou d'autres applications, le web scraping offre de nombreuses possibilités. Cependant, il est important de respecter les règles d'éthique et de légalité lors de la pratique du web scraping, afin de ne pas porter atteinte aux droits d'auteur ou à la vie privée des utilisateurs. En suivant les bonnes pratiques et en utilisant les outils appropriés, vous pouvez tirer le meilleur parti du web scraping pour obtenir des informations précieuses et prendre des décisions éclairées.
Pour en savoir plus sur le web scraping, vous pouvez consulter les ressources supplémentaires suivantes :
N'oubliez pas que le web scraping doit être utilisé de manière responsable et éthique, en respectant les droits d'auteur et la vie privée des utilisateurs.